MBCx under LEED v5: from manual review to required software

Aug 6, 2026, 8:15:00 AM

The U.S. Green Building Council rolled out its latest guidelines for green buildings in April 2025 as LEED v5. While the overall objective of setting a framework for efficient, green buildings remains the same, the methodology, point allocation, and requirements have some substantial differences. For us at Cx Associates, one of the changes that most affects our work is the expanded role of software in monitoring-based commissioning (MBCx).

What's changing

usgbc-sstock-2417625271MBCx uses review of building automation system data, or electrical system monitoring and
metered data, to identify faults, operational inefficiencies, energy-saving opportunities, or failed equipment. Under LEED v4.1, this could be accomplished through manual review of data every quarter. LEED v5 makes software an explicit part of the MBCx credit: rather than relying solely on periodic manual review, projects must use a software platform to analyze building performance data, visualize energy use at an hourly or finer resolution, and help identify faults, inefficiencies, and equipment or control problems. Quarterly summaries and reporting remain part of the process, but the underlying monitoring and analysis are now software-supported.

This is more than swapping a quarterly spreadsheet review for a dashboard. Building and running a fully functional software solution is a fundamentally different undertaking than the manual review it replaces. Done well, software greatly improves the odds of catching system deficiencies early — but it requires thoughtful development that knows what to look for and when to raise an alarm, plus human judgment to sort through what the software flags. Engineering-led EMIS

Our EMIS service is designed and implemented by building engineers. We've worked with building owners and operators for decades — from construction through retro-commissioning to full system recommissioning — identifying issues during construction, immediately after construction, and after decades of use. That experience means we know what to look for: the specific variables and signatures that actually indicate a problem, and how to establish a proper baseline.

Getting the baseline right matters more than most people realize. Without enough data collected across the full range of a building's operating conditions, the models underpinning fault detection won't fit well, and you end up chasing ghosts or missing real issues entirely.
